Abstract

La invencion es un sistema de soporte para uso con un recipiente de reactor que define una zona de reactor y tiene un pozo de acceso de conexion de entrada que provee una abertura dentro de la zona del reactor. El sistema de soporte comprende un inserto del pozo de acceso que esta soportado por el pozo de acceso de la conexion de entrada y se extiende a traves de la abertura del pozo de acceso de la conexion de entrada y dentro de la zona de reactor. Anexo al pozo de acceso estan medios de conexion para conector la barra de suspension al inserto del pozo de acceso y para transferir la carga de la barra de suspension al inserto del pozo de acceso. La barra de suspension de soporte tiene un extremo superior y un extremo inferior con el extremo superior estando fijamente conectado a los medios de fijacion y el extremo inferior estando fijamente conectados a los medios de la estructura de soporte para soportar una carga.
